Why Cloud Technologies Are Essential for Omnichannel Retail

Omnichannel retail requires a unified, connected experience across all touchpoints. Cloud technology enables:

  • Real-time inventory and order visibility
  • Centralized customer data management
  • Personalized shopping experiences at scale
  • Scalable infrastructure for rapid growth
  • Faster innovation through APIs and microservices

Cloud platforms eliminate data silos and allow businesses to orchestrate consistent brand experiences across all channels.


Top Cloud Technologies Driving Omnichannel Retail Success

1. Cloud-Based POS Systems

Modern Point-of-Sale (POS) systems in the cloud allow real-time synchronization between physical stores and digital channels.

Benefits:

  • Unified inventory and pricing
  • Centralized transaction data
  • Support for mobile checkout and endless aisle experiences

Popular tools: Square, Shopify POS, Lightspeed Retail


2. Headless Commerce Platforms

Headless commerce decouples the frontend from the backend, offering ultimate flexibility in delivering omnichannel shopping experiences.

Benefits:

  • Consistent UX across web, mobile, kiosks, and IoT
  • Faster rollout of new digital experiences
  • Easier integration with third-party apps and APIs

Popular tools: BigCommerce, CommerceTools, Adobe Commerce (Magento)


3. Cloud-Based CRM and CDP Systems

Customer Relationship Management (CRM) and Customer Data Platforms (CDP) aggregate insights across touchpoints for personalized engagement.

Benefits:

  • 360° customer view
  • AI-driven segmentation and targeting
  • Omnichannel campaign automation

Popular tools: Salesforce, HubSpot, Segment, Bloomreach


4. Real-Time Inventory and Order Management Systems (OMS)

Omnichannel success depends on inventory accuracy and flexible fulfillment options like BOPIS (Buy Online, Pick Up In Store) and ship-from-store.

Benefits:

  • Real-time inventory updates
  • Dynamic order routing
  • Reduced stockouts and overselling

Popular tools: NetSuite, IBM Sterling, Fluent Commerce


5. AI-Powered Personalization Engines

Personalized shopping journeys are now expected, not optional. AI in the cloud enables dynamic product recommendations, promotions, and content delivery.

Benefits:

  • Increased conversion rates
  • Better customer retention
  • Real-time adaptation to behavior and preferences

Popular tools: Dynamic Yield, Algolia, Google Recommendations AI


6. Cloud-Based Analytics and BI Platforms

Data-driven decision-making is vital. Cloud-native analytics platforms bring visibility into customer behavior, channel performance, and operational metrics.

Benefits:

  • Centralized dashboards
  • Predictive insights
  • Integration with marketing and sales tools

Popular tools: Google BigQuery, Microsoft Power BI, Tableau Cloud


7. Cloud Contact Center and Customer Support Solutions

Exceptional omnichannel service includes seamless customer support across chat, email, phone, and social.

Benefits:

  • Unified communication history
  • AI chatbots for 24/7 service
  • Integration with CRM for personalized interactions

Popular tools: Zendesk, Freshdesk, Amazon Connect


8. Cloud Infrastructure and DevOps Platforms

Behind the scenes, agile infrastructure powers innovation. Cloud providers offer scalability, security, and deployment flexibility across regions.

Benefits:

  • High availability and disaster recovery
  • Continuous delivery pipelines
  • Auto-scaling for traffic spikes

Popular tools: AWS, Microsoft Azure, Google Cloud Platform


How to Choose the Right Cloud Technologies

When selecting cloud tools for omnichannel retail, consider:

  • Integration capabilities with existing systems
  • Ease of use for staff and customers
  • Scalability to support seasonal or global growth
  • AI and automation features
  • Security and compliance readiness

A smart approach is to build a modular cloud architecture using best-of-breed solutions that support open APIs and cross-platform functionality.
